Football is by far the most popular sport in France, both in terms of practice and audience. For the 2008–2009 season, there were about 17,750 clubs affiliated to the French Football Federation (FFF, hereafter French FA), with a total membership of 2.2 million licensees, almost exclusively masculine (2.7 percent of women). These clubs, playing an estimated total of 1 million matches per year, employ about 7,000 people and rely on the implication of 350,000 volunteers. 1 Average attendance to a League 1 match is around 20,000. Though the French FA is a non-profit association with a public service mission, it has an increasing commercial dimension and its sales revenue amounted to €205 millions in 2008–2009. That same year, total revenue of Ligue 1 clubs was close to €1.3 billion. 2
